HHREC and WJC Annual Countywide Yom Hashoah Commemoration

Holocaust & Human Rights Education Center and Westchester Jewish Council –Annual Westchester Countywide Yom Hashoah Holocaust Commemoration

Keeping the Memory Alive: Generation to Generation featuring Holocaust survivor, Agnes Vertes as the keynote speaker and the procession of Westchester’s rescued Holocaust Torahs.

Thursday, April 12, 12:00 PM to 1:00 PM

Garden of Remembrance, 148 Martine Avenue, White Plains, NY 10601

Free and Open to All.

Rain or Shine.
